Key Insights of Japan Monocrystalline Silicon Quartz Crucible Market
- Market Size (2023): Estimated at approximately $450 million, reflecting Japan’s dominant role in high-purity quartz crucible production.
- Forecast Value (2026): Projected to reach $620 million, driven by rising demand from semiconductor fabrication and solar cell manufacturing.
- CAGR (2026–2033): Approximately 4.8%, indicating steady growth amid technological and geopolitical shifts.
- Leading Segment: High-purity quartz crucibles (>99.99% purity) dominate, especially in semiconductor applications.
- Core Application: Semiconductors account for over 70% of demand, with photovoltaic applications gaining momentum.
- Leading Geography: Japan holds over 60% market share, leveraging advanced manufacturing capabilities and R&D infrastructure.
- Key Market Opportunity: Expansion into next-generation ultra-pure crucibles for 3D chip stacking and advanced packaging.
- Major Companies: Shin-Etsu Chemical, Tosoh Quartz, and Mitsubishi Materials are the primary players shaping the market landscape.

Japan Monocrystalline Silicon Quartz Crucible Market Supply Chain and Value Chain Analysis
The supply chain for Japan’s quartz crucible industry is highly integrated, with raw material sourcing, manufacturing, and distribution tightly coordinated. High-purity quartz sand, sourced domestically and internationally, forms the foundation of the value chain, with Japanese firms investing in refining and purification processes to meet stringent quality standards. Manufacturing involves sophisticated melting, molding, and quality assurance processes, often utilizing proprietary technologies.
The value chain extends to end-user integration, with close collaborations between material suppliers and semiconductor/fabrication equipment manufacturers. Japan’s emphasis on quality control and process innovation ensures a seamless flow from raw material extraction to final product delivery. Challenges include geopolitical risks affecting raw material supply and the need for continuous technological upgrades to meet evolving industry standards. Strategic partnerships and vertical integration are key to maintaining supply chain resilience and competitive advantage.
